How do blends look in remastered?

I will eventually get remastered and see for myself but for right now, I haven't because the editor is still old graphics. For people who have remastered, do terrain blends still look like they're supposed to? What about stacked buildings that are specifically placed to hide x feature of y building.

They look like complete trash mostly. Even blends that look completely perfect previously could have a line going through it now.

For example, in Jungle there are 2 bridge to dirt tiles that look EXACTLY the same and are indistinguishable. However, in the remaster they look completely different and there would be absolutely no way to confuse them.

It CAN go the opposite way too. There are some blends that look bad on SD but good on HD.
